    I am looking at booking a stay at a Disney resort for 5 days but am only going to be in the parks for 3 days. If I get the dining add on will that cover all 5 days or just the three at the parks?

    When you book a Magic Your Way Vacation Package, there is quite a bit of flexibility that comes with your package. A package includes a Resort Hotel Room, Theme Park Tickets and if you wish, one of the Disney Dining Plans.  In order to add a Disney Dining Plan to your Reservation, you will also need to add at least a Two-Day Theme Park Ticket.  Since you would like to visit a Theme Park for three days, you will be able to add the Disney Dining Plan. 

    The Disney Dining Plan Works differently than the Theme Park Tickets.  If you choose to purchase one of the Disney Dining Plans, it will be added to the entire length of your stay for every guest in your party.  Your entitlements are calculated per night of your stay, so what that means is if you are staying for 5 days (4 nights) with the Disney Dining Plan each person on your Reservation will have 4 Table-Service Entitlements, 4 Quick-Service Entitlements and 8 Snacks to use throughout the length of your stay.
